interesting trumpet banner not all that uncommon to see this type of thing for special occasions still rare but these are found for many of the rallies associated with common tinnies

:canada1
 
tinnes are the various day badges given out for attendees at rallies and functions and on many occasions given out for donations but things like the REICHPARTAG RALLIES had tinnies and these type of banners made for them and the tinnies where made in the millions thus still flood the market today. Your banner is associated with such a tinnie
